117,060 (one hundred seventeen thousand sixty)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 3 × 5 × 1,951. Its proper divisors sum to 210,876,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1C944.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 117060, here are decompositions:

  • 7 + 117053 = 117060
  • 17 + 117043 = 117060
  • 19 + 117041 = 117060
  • 23 + 117037 = 117060
  • 37 + 117023 = 117060
  • 43 + 117017 = 117060
  • 67 + 116993 = 117060
  • 71 + 116989 = 117060

Showing the first eight; more decompositions exist.
